Zhang Qiao ab2bc893b7 sched/fair: sanitize vruntime of entity being placed
commit 829c1651e9 upstream.

When a scheduling entity is placed onto cfs_rq, its vruntime is pulled
to the base level (around cfs_rq->min_vruntime), so that the entity
doesn't gain extra boost when placed backwards.

However, if the entity being placed wasn't executed for a long time, its
vruntime may get too far behind (e.g. while cfs_rq was executing a
low-weight hog), which can inverse the vruntime comparison due to s64
overflow.  This results in the entity being placed with its original
vruntime way forwards, so that it will effectively never get to the cpu.

To prevent that, ignore the vruntime of the entity being placed if it
didn't execute for much longer than the characteristic sheduler time
scale.

Mike Snitzer f2edd6b91d dm crypt: avoid accessing uninitialized tasklet
commit d9a02e016a upstream.

When neither "no_read_workqueue" nor "no_write_workqueue" are enabled,
tasklet_trylock() in crypt_dec_pending() may still return false due to
an uninitialized state, and dm-crypt will unnecessarily do io completion
in io_queue workqueue instead of current context.

Fix this by adding an 'in_tasklet' flag to dm_crypt_io struct and
initialize it to false in crypt_io_init(). Set this flag to true in
kcryptd_queue_crypt() before calling tasklet_schedule(). If set
crypt_dec_pending() will punt io completion to a workqueue.

This also nicely avoids the tasklet_trylock/unlock hack when tasklets
aren't in use.

Nathan Chancellor a4c2888656 riscv: Handle zicsr/zifencei issues between clang and binutils
commit e89c2e815e upstream.

There are two related issues that appear in certain combinations with
clang and GNU binutils.

The first occurs when a version of clang that supports zicsr or zifencei
via '-march=' [1] (i.e, >= 17.x) is used in combination with a version
of GNU binutils that do not recognize zicsr and zifencei in the
'-march=' value (i.e., < 2.36):

  riscv64-linux-gnu-ld: -march=rv64i2p0_m2p0_a2p0_c2p0_zicsr2p0_zifencei2p0: Invalid or unknown z ISA extension: 'zifencei'
  riscv64-linux-gnu-ld: failed to merge target specific data of file fs/efivarfs/file.o
  riscv64-linux-gnu-ld: -march=rv64i2p0_m2p0_a2p0_c2p0_zicsr2p0_zifencei2p0: Invalid or unknown z ISA extension: 'zifencei'
  riscv64-linux-gnu-ld: failed to merge target specific data of file fs/efivarfs/super.o

The second occurs when a version of clang that does not support zicsr or
zifencei via '-march=' (i.e., <= 16.x) is used in combination with a
version of GNU as that defaults to a newer ISA base spec, which requires
specifying zicsr and zifencei in the '-march=' value explicitly (i.e, >=
2.38):

  ../arch/riscv/kernel/kexec_relocate.S: Assembler messages:
  ../arch/riscv/kernel/kexec_relocate.S:147: Error: unrecognized opcode `fence.i', extension `zifencei' required
  clang-12: error: assembler command failed with exit code 1 (use -v to see invocation)

This is the same issue addressed by commit 6df2a016c0 ("riscv: fix
build with binutils 2.38") (see [2] for additional information) but
older versions of clang miss out on it because the cc-option check
fails:

  clang-12: error: invalid arch name 'rv64imac_zicsr_zifencei', unsupported standard user-level extension 'zicsr'
  clang-12: error: invalid arch name 'rv64imac_zicsr_zifencei', unsupported standard user-level extension 'zicsr'

To resolve the first issue, only attempt to add zicsr and zifencei to
the march string when using the GNU assembler 2.38 or newer, which is
when the default ISA spec was updated, requiring these extensions to be
specified explicitly. LLVM implements an older version of the base
specification for all currently released versions, so these instructions
are available as part of the 'i' extension. If LLVM's implementation is
updated in the future, a CONFIG_AS_IS_LLVM condition can be added to
CONFIG_TOOLCHAIN_NEEDS_EXPLICIT_ZICSR_ZIFENCEI.

To resolve the second issue, use version 2.2 of the base ISA spec when
using an older version of clang that does not support zicsr or zifencei
via '-march=', as that is the spec version most compatible with the one
clang/LLVM implements and avoids the need to specify zicsr and zifencei
explicitly due to still being a part of 'i'.

Ryusuke Konishi 8a6550b365 nilfs2: fix kernel-infoleak in nilfs_ioctl_wrap_copy()
commit 0035870002 upstream.

The ioctl helper function nilfs_ioctl_wrap_copy(), which exchanges a
metadata array to/from user space, may copy uninitialized buffer regions
to user space memory for read-only ioctl commands NILFS_IOCTL_GET_SUINFO
and NILFS_IOCTL_GET_CPINFO.

This can occur when the element size of the user space metadata given by
the v_size member of the argument nilfs_argv structure is larger than the
size of the metadata element (nilfs_suinfo structure or nilfs_cpinfo
structure) on the file system side.

Liam R. Howlett 48c4274507 maple_tree: fix mas_skip_node() end slot detection
commit 0fa99fdfe1 upstream.

Patch series "Fix mas_skip_node() for mas_empty_area()", v2.

mas_empty_area() was incorrectly returning an error when there was room.
The issue was tracked down to mas_skip_node() using the incorrect
end-of-slot count.  Instead of using the nodes hard limit, the limit of
data should be used.

mas_skip_node() was also setting the min and max to that of the child
node, which was unnecessary.  Within these limits being set, there was
also a bug that corrupted the maple state's max if the offset was set to
the maximum node pivot.  The bug was without consequence unless there was
a sufficient gap in the next child node which would cause an error to be
returned.

This patch set fixes these errors by removing the limit setting from
mas_skip_node() and uses the mas_data_end() for slot limits, and adds
tests for all failures discovered.


This patch (of 2):

mas_skip_node() is used to move the maple state to the node with a higher
limit.  It does this by walking up the tree and increasing the slot count.
Since slot count may not be able to be increased, it may need to walk up
multiple times to find room to walk right to a higher limit node.  The
limit of slots that was being used was the node limit and not the last
location of data in the node.  This would cause the maple state to be
shifted outside actual data and enter an error state, thus returning
-EBUSY.

The result of the incorrect error state means that mas_awalk() would
return an error instead of finding the allocation space.

The fix is to use mas_data_end() in mas_skip_node() to detect the nodes
data end point and continue walking the tree up until it is safe to move
to a node with a higher limit.

The walk up the tree also sets the maple state limits so remove the buggy
code from mas_skip_node().  Setting the limits had the unfortunate side
effect of triggering another bug if the parent node was full and the there
was no suitable gap in the second last child, but room in the next child.

mas_skip_node() may also be passed a maple state in an error state from
mas_anode_descend() when no allocations are available.  Return on such an
error state immediately.

Peter Collingbourne 03102d224f Revert "kasan: drop skip_kasan_poison variable in free_pages_prepare"
commit f446883d12 upstream.

This reverts commit 487a32ec24.

should_skip_kasan_poison() reads the PG_skip_kasan_poison flag from
page->flags.  However, this line of code in free_pages_prepare():

	page->flags &= ~PAGE_FLAGS_CHECK_AT_PREP;

clears most of page->flags, including PG_skip_kasan_poison, before calling
should_skip_kasan_poison(), which meant that it would never return true as
a result of the page flag being set.  Therefore, fix the code to call
should_skip_kasan_poison() before clearing the flags, as we were doing
before the reverted patch.

This fixes a measurable performance regression introduced in the reverted
commit, where munmap() takes longer than intended if HW tags KASAN is
supported and enabled at runtime.  Without this patch, we see a
single-digit percentage performance regression in a particular
mmap()-heavy benchmark when enabling HW tags KASAN, and with the patch,
there is no statistically significant performance impact when enabling HW
tags KASAN.

Wesley Cheng 9060decc22 usb: dwc3: gadget: Add 1ms delay after end transfer command without IOC
commit d8a2bb4eb7 upstream.

Previously, there was a 100uS delay inserted after issuing an end transfer
command for specific controller revisions.  This was due to the fact that
there was a GUCTL2 bit field which enabled synchronous completion of the
end transfer command once the CMDACT bit was cleared in the DEPCMD
register.  Since this bit does not exist for all controller revisions and
the current implementation heavily relies on utizling the EndTransfer
command completion interrupt, add the delay back in for uses where the
interrupt on completion bit is not set, and increase the duration to 1ms
for the controller to complete the command.

An issue was seen where the USB request buffer was unmapped while the DWC3
controller was still accessing the TRB.  However, it was confirmed that the
end transfer command was successfully submitted. (no end transfer timeout)
In situations, such as dwc3_gadget_soft_disconnect() and
__dwc3_gadget_ep_disable(), the dwc3_remove_request() is utilized, which
will issue the end transfer command, and follow up with
dwc3_gadget_giveback().  At least for the USB ep disable path, it is
required for any pending and started requests to be completed and returned
to the function driver in the same context of the disable call.  Without
the GUCTL2 bit, it is not ensured that the end transfer is completed before
the buffers are unmapped.
